MATTER OF POSNER v. WOHLPART


26 A.D.2d 830 (1966)

In the Matter of Benjamin C. Posner et al., Appellants, v. Joseph Wohlpart et al., Respondents

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

October 24, 1966


Judgment affirmed, with costs.

No opinion.

Hill, J., dissents and votes to reverse the judgment, to annul the determination and to direct the issuance of a permit, with the following memorandum:
